The best house shoes for achilles tendonitis share a few non-negotiable features: a slight heel lift (8 to 15mm), real arch support, cushioned soles that absorb impact, and a heel cup that does not dig into the back of your tendon.

Achilles tendonitis affects the band of tissue connecting your calf muscles to your heel bone. When you walk barefoot on hard floors or wear flat slippers all day, that tendon stays in a stretched position and never gets a break. Supportive house shoes take pressure off the tendon by lifting the heel slightly and giving the arch something to push against. I noticed during testing that mornings after wearing arch-supported house shoes felt dramatically less stiff than mornings spent shuffling around in flat socks or unsupportive slippers.

What to Look for in House Shoes for Achilles Tendonitis

Choosing the right house shoes for Achilles tendonitis requires understanding which features actually help the tendon recover. After testing 8 pairs and consulting podiatry resources, we identified the features that matter most. This buying guide explains what to prioritize when shopping.

Heel lift and heel-to-toe drop

The most important feature for Achilles tendonitis is a slight heel lift. Podiatrists recommend 8 to 15mm of heel elevation to take tension off the Achilles tendon. When your heel sits slightly higher than your toes, the tendon stays in a shortened position rather than stretching with every step. Flat slippers force the tendon to stretch constantly, which worsens inflammation.

Look for slippers with a clearly raised heel or a contoured footbed that lifts the rearfoot. Memory foam slippers compress over time and may lose their lift, so consider replacing them every 6-12 months if you wear them daily.

Arch support that matches your foot type

Arch support prevents your arch from flattening with each step, which in turn reduces the strain on your Achilles tendon. When the arch collapses, the calf muscles work harder to stabilize you, pulling on the Achilles. Proper arch support breaks this compensation cycle.

Match the arch height to your foot type. People with flat feet need higher, more aggressive arch support. People with high arches need moderate arch support that fills the gap under the arch. Standard memory foam slippers offer minimal arch support, so consider orthopedic-specific options if your arches collapse.

Cushioning that absorbs heel strike

Cushioning matters because every step sends impact up through your heel into the Achilles tendon. Dense memory foam or EVA foam absorbs this shock before it reaches the tendon. Soft, thin cushioning bottoms out quickly and fails to absorb impact.

Test cushioning by pressing firmly with your thumb. Quality foam rebounds within 2-3 seconds. Foam that stays compressed or feels thin offers minimal shock absorption. Replace slippers when the foam stays compressed permanently.

Heel cup depth and back design

A deep heel cup cradles your heel and prevents side-to-side rolling. This stability keeps the Achilles in a neutral position rather than twisting with foot motion. Shallow heel cups or flat soles allow the foot to roll, which twists the tendon.

Avoid slippers with rigid backs that press into the Achilles insertion. A slightly padded, flexible heel collar provides structure without rubbing. If the back of the slipper creates a red mark on your skin, it is applying too much pressure to the tendon.

Fit and adjustability

Proper fit matters because tight slippers compress the foot and worsen swelling, while loose slippers allow the foot to slide and create compensatory strain. Look for slippers with adjustable straps (velcro or hook-and-loop) that let you customize the fit throughout the day.

Your feet swell during the day, especially during inflammation. Slippers that fit perfectly in the morning may feel tight by evening. Adjustable closures accommodate this swelling without requiring you to remove the shoes.

Materials and breathability

Breathable materials prevent moisture buildup, which can worsen skin irritation around the heel. Waffle knit, mesh, and natural fibers breathe better than synthetic plastics. If you run hot or live in a warm climate, prioritize breathability.

For cold environments, fleece or fur-lined slippers provide warmth. The Achilles area stays sensitive during inflammation, and warmth can improve blood flow to the tendon. Match the material to your climate and personal temperature preferences.

Sizing and break-in considerations

Most orthopedic slippers run slightly small due to the contoured footbeds. If you are between sizes or plan to wear thick socks, consider ordering up half a size. The slipper should feel snug but not tight, with enough room for toes to wiggle.

Most house shoes for achilles tendonitis require a break-in period of about a week. The footbed molds to your foot shape, and the materials soften slightly. Wear them for short periods initially and gradually increase wear time as the slippers break in.

The right house shoes will not cure Achilles tendonitis on their own, but they create the foundation for recovery by taking daily strain off the tendon. Pair supportive house shoes with stretching, rest, and consultation with a healthcare provider for persistent pain.
